Система HiveOS представляет собой специализированную операционную среду, созданную для майнинга криптовалют, где стабильность работы видеочипов играет решающую роль. Часто пользователи сталкиваются с ситуацией, когда автоматическое обновление драйверов не происходит или приводит к ошибкам в работе алгоритмов майнинга. В таких случаях необходимо знать, как самостоятельно и корректно установить драйвер Nvidia, чтобы восстановить производительность фермы.
Процесс обновления программного обеспечения для видеокарт в Linux-среде имеет свои особенности, отличающиеся от привычного взаимодействия с Windows. Вам потребуется доступ к командной строке, так как графический интерфейс в HiveOS не всегда предоставляет инструменты для глубокой настройки драйверов. Игнорирование обновлений или использование неподходящей версии ПО может привести к падению хешрейта или полному отказу карт от работы.
Подготовка системы перед обновлением
Перед тем как приступить к непосредственной инсталляции нового драйвера, необходимо убедиться в целостности текущей системы и наличии стабильного соединения с интернетом. Если вы планируете массовое обновление, важно проверить состояние каждой карты в панели управления HiveOS Dashboard. Ошибки в сетевом подключении могут привести к прерыванию скачивания архивов, что повлечет за собой повреждение системных библиотек.
Рекомендуется создать резервную копию конфигурационных файлов ваших кошельков и настроек рига, если вы используете кастомные скрипты. Хотя сам драйвер не затрагивает пользовательские файлы, операция перезагрузки после установки может выявить скрытые конфликты в настройках. Убедитесь, что у вас есть доступ к консоли через SSH или терминал, встроенный в веб-интерфейс.
Драйверы Nvidia для майнинга часто требуют специфических версий ядра Linux, которые могут не поддерживать новейшие графические пакеты. Проверьте текущую версию ядра командой uname -r в терминале. Если система просит обновить ядро, делайте это только после ознакомления с совместимостью выбранной версии драйвера.
⚠️ Внимание: Если вы используете кастомные ядра для разгона, установка официального драйвера может сбросить ваши модификации. Всегда сверяйте совместимость версии драйвера с вашей версией ядра перед началом процесса.
Установка драйвера через консоль SSH
Основной метод обновления драйверов в HiveOS осуществляется через стандартные репозитории, доступные в системе. Вам не нужно скачивать инсталляторы вручную с сайта производителя, так как система интегрирована с официальными пакетами. Для начала необходимо открыть терминал и убедиться, что вы находитесь в корне системы или имеет права суперпользователя.
Сначала обновите список доступных пакетов, чтобы система «увидела» последние версии драйверов. Выполните команду sudo apt-get update. После этого следует проверить наличие доступных обновлений для пакета драйверов. В зависимости от версии HiveOS, пакет может называться nvidia-driver-470 или nvidia-driver-535. Использование актуального пакета драйверов критично для поддержки новых алгоритмов майнинга.
Для установки конкретного драйвера используйте команду с указанием версии. Например, для установки версии 470 команда будет выглядеть так:
sudo apt-get install nvidia-driver-470 Система может запросить подтверждение на загрузку и установку зависимостей. Подтвердите действие вводом Y и дождитесь окончания процесса, который может занять несколько минут.
☑️ Подготовка к установке
После завершения установки система предложит перезагрузку. В большинстве случаев перезагрузка обязательна для корректной инициализации нового ядра модуля Nvidia. Не пытайтесь запустить майнер сразу после завершения инсталляции без перезагрузки — карта может не определиться в системе.
⚠️ Внимание: Если после установки драйвера система не загружается, вам потребуется загрузиться в режим восстановления или использовать загрузочную флешку для восстановления конфигурации. Не игнорируйте сообщения об ошибках при загрузке.
Выбор правильной версии драйвера
Не существует единой «лучшей» версии драйвера для всех видеокарт и алгоритмов. Выбор зависит от архитектуры вашего GPU и типа используемого программного обеспечения для майнинга. Для карт серии RTX 3000 и RTX 4000 обычно требуются более свежие драйверы, чем для старых моделей 10-й серии. Использование неподходящей версии может привести к снижению производительности или нестабильности.
Существует несколько категорий драйверов: стандартные (Game Ready), профессиональные (Studio) и специализированные для серверов или майнинга. В HiveOS чаще всего используются стандартные драйверы, адаптированные под Linux. Проверьте рекомендации разработчиков ваших майнеров, так как они часто указывают минимальную и рекомендуемую версию драйвера.
Вот основные характеристики, которые стоит учитывать при выборе:
- 🚀 Поддержка новых алгоритмов — свежие драйверы часто содержат исправления для новых алгоритмов майнинга.
- 💪 Стабильность работы — проверенные версии драйверов реже вызывают вылеты системы.
- 🔧 Совместимость с ядром — убедитесь, что версия драйвера поддерживает текущую версию ядра Linux в вашей системе.
Почему нельзя ставить самую новую версию?|Иногда самые свежие драйверы содержат баги, которые не были обнаружены разработчиками. В майнинге цена ошибки — простой оборудования и потеря прибыли. Лучше использовать версию, которая прошла тестирование сообществом в течение 2-3 недель после выхода.
Проверка корректности установки
После перезагрузки необходимо убедиться, что система успешно определила видеокарты и готова к работе. Самый простой способ проверить состояние драйверов — использовать утилиту nvidia-smi. Введите эту команду в терминале, и вы увидите таблицу с информацией о установленных картах, их температуре и загрузке памяти.
Если команда возвращает ошибку «command not found» или «NVIDIA-SMI has failed because it couldn't communicate with the NVIDIA driver», значит, установка прошла неудачно или модуль ядра не загрузился. В этом случае попробуйте переустановить драйвер или проверить логирование ошибок в файле /var/log/syslog.
Для детальной проверки можно использовать утилиту lspci | grep -i nvidia, чтобы убедиться, что оборудование определено на уровне ядра. В таблице ниже представлены типичные статусы, которые вы можете увидеть при проверке
nvidia-smi. Введите эту команду в терминале, и вы увидите таблицу с информацией о установленных картах, их температуре и загрузке памяти./var/log/syslog.lspci | grep -i nvidia, чтобы убедиться, что оборудование определено на уровне ядра. В таблице ниже представлены типичные статусы, которые вы можете увидеть при проверке| Статус | Описание | Действие |
|---|---|---|
| OK | Драйвер установлен и работает корректно | Запуск майнера |
| Failed | Ошибка инициализации модуля | Переустановка драйвера |
| Not Found | Драйвер не найден в системе | Проверка репозиториев |
| Unsupported | Версия драйвера не подходит для карты | Смена версии драйвера |
Также стоит обратить внимание на температуру и частоты. Если картами управляет HiveOS, они должны отображаться в панели управления с корректными показателями. Если карты отображаются как «Unknown» или с неверными температурами, возможно, требуется обновление модулей мониторинга.
Решение частых проблем при установке
Иногда процесс установки может быть заблокирован из-за конфликтов с предыдущими версиями драйверов. В таких случаях рекомендуется полностью удалить старый драйвер перед установкой нового. Используйте команду sudo apt-get purge 'nvidia' для очистки системы от всех компонентов Nvidia.
Еще одна частая проблема — нехватка дискового пространства. Обновили драйвер, но система пишет об ошибке записи? Проверьте свободное место в разделе / командой df -h. Если место закончилось, очистите кэш пакетов командой sudo apt-get clean или удалите ненужные логи.
Если после обновления вы наблюдаете снижение хешрейта, возможно, настройки разгона сбросились до заводских. Вам придется заново применить кастомные настройки для каждой карты в интерфейсе HiveOS. Не забывайте сохранять профили разгона в облаке, чтобы быстро восстановить их после сбоя.
⚠️ Внимание: При использовании кастомных настроек разгона после обновления драйвера всегда начинайте с минимальных значений. Новые версии драйверов могут по-разному интерпретировать старые настройки, что приведет к нестабильности.
Автоматизация процесса обновления
Для владельцев крупных ферм ручное обновление каждой машины может быть утомительным процессом. В HiveOS существует возможность массового обновления через веб-интерфейс. Зайдите в раздел «Rigs» (Риги), выберите нужные устройства и используйте функцию «Update» для установки обновлений драйверов на все выбранные машины одновременно.
Однако автоматическое обновление требует тщательной настройки. Убедитесь, что функция автообновления не включена по умолчанию, если вы не уверены в совместимости новой версии. Рекомендуется тестировать обновление на одном риге перед запуском на всей ферме. Это позволит избежать массового простоя оборудования.
Планируйте обновления на время, когда ферма работает с минимальной нагрузкой или когда вы можете позволить себе кратковременный простой. Ошибки при обновлении могут потребовать времени на восстановление, которое будет потрачено впустую. Используйте расписание обновлений в настройках системы для автоматизации процесса в безопасные часы.
Итоги и рекомендации по поддержке
Установка драйверов Nvidia на HiveOS — это рутинная, но критически важная задача для поддержания эффективности майнинга. Регулярное обновление ПО обеспечивает совместимость с новыми алгоритмами и исправляет ошибки безопасности. Однако не стоит гнаться за каждой новинкой; выбирайте стабильные версии, проверенные сообществом.
Всегда держите под рукой инструкции по откату на предыдущую версию драйвера, если новая версия вызывает проблемы. Наличие четкого плана действий при сбоях сэкономит вам время и нервы. Помните, что стабильность фермы важнее попыток выжать максимальный хешрейт на нестабильном софте.
Соблюдение рекомендаций по выбору версии, подготовке системы и проверке результатов позволит вам поддерживать оборудование в отличном состоянии. Следите за официальными новостями HiveOS и форумами сообщества, чтобы быть в курсе последних изменений и рекомендаций по настройке ваших видеокарт.
Что делать, если команда nvidia-smi не работает?
Если команда nvidia-smi возвращает ошибку, это может означать, что драйвер не установлен или модуль ядра не загрузился. Попробуйте перезагрузить систему. Если это не помогло, проверьте установленные пакеты командой dpkg -l | grep nvidia. Возможно, потребуется переустановка драйвера через apt-get или использование скрипта восстановления.
Можно ли обновлять драйвер без перезагрузки?
Технически некоторые изменения могут вступить в силу без полной перезагрузки, но для корректной работы графического ядра и модулей майнинга перезагрузка практически всегда обязательна. Без неё система может использовать старые библиотеки, что приведет к ошибкам в работе майнера.
Какую версию драйвера выбрать для RTX 3060 Ti?
Для карт серии RTX 3000 рекомендуется использовать драйвер версии 470 или новее (например, 535), так как они обеспечивают лучшую поддержку архитектуры Ampere. Однако всегда проверяйте совместимость с конкретным майнером, который вы используете, так как некоторые старые майнеры могут требовать более старые версии.
Где посмотреть логи ошибок драйвера?
Логи драйвера Nvidia обычно находятся в файлах /var/log/syslog или /var/log/Xorg.0.log. Вы можете просматривать их в режиме реального времени с помощью команды tail -f /var/log/syslog или искать конкретные ошибки в истории. Ищите строки, содержащие ключевые слова "NVIDIA", "fail", "error".